Title: The Innovations of Shinichi Kuwahara
Introduction
Shinichi Kuwahara is a notable inventor based in Saitama,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of vehicle technology, particularly in motorcycle design and hydraulic systems. With a total of seven patents to his name, Kuwahara's work reflects a commitment to enhancing vehicle performance and safety.
Latest Patents
Among his latest patents is an innovative arrangement structure of a rear master cylinder and a hydraulic fluid reservoir tank in a saddle-riding type vehicle. This design includes a vehicle body and a pivot frame that supports a swing arm for rear wheel suspension. The rear master cylinder is strategically placed rearwardly of the pivot frame, while the reservoir tank is positioned between the pivot frame and the rear master cylinder. This configuration allows for efficient hydraulic fluid supply and optimizes space within the vehicle.
Another significant patent is for a radially mounted disk brake. This invention features a caliper body secured to a support member attached to the vehicle body. The design includes mounting holes that extend perpendicularly to the axis of rotation of a disk rotor. Large-diameter hole portions are formed at the openings of these mounting holes, allowing for effective fitting and performance of the brake system.
Career Highlights
Shinichi Kuwahara has worked with prominent companies in the automotive industry, including Honda Giken Kogyo Kabushiki Kaisha and Honda Motor Co., Ltd. His experience in these organizations has allowed him to develop and refine his innovative ideas, contributing to advancements in motorcycle technology.
